Transaction f8e70fb2c81aa344cd5fe4878843a0963d488dc2b0b04ef78d68a4aa68122094

1 Input
2 Outputs
  • f8e70fb2c81aa344cd5fe4878843a0963d488dc2b0b04ef78d68a4aa68122094:0
  • value  2898917
    address  3QAcmwu1BVNEZWfpaQ9wsaC38rfASbxrsb
  • f8e70fb2c81aa344cd5fe4878843a0963d488dc2b0b04ef78d68a4aa68122094:1
  • value  2039101
    address  13PmuEFs6aUammeRqcRQczSgzsmXobARgS